N-Power: Buhari govt moves to disengage 200, 000 beneficiaries

Writer's picture: AdminAdmin

The Senior Special Assistant to President Muhammadu Buhari on Social Investment, Maryam Uwais, has disclosed that the Nigerian government was working on how to “disengage” over 200,000 beneficiaries of the government’s social intervention programme, N-Power.

Uwais made the disclosure while featuring on Nigerian Television Authority, NTA.

She disclosed that the government was in talks with the Finance ministry on the next plan for those to be disengaged.

“We are trying to see how we can address some of these gaps through these N-power beneficiaries that are meant to be disengaged by end of the year.

“We are looking out loans to be made available to them, it has not be finalized yet with the finance ministry,” she said.
